Dion Schrack, Executive Administrator

Dion began working at St. Francis Manor in 1982 and has been instrumental in growing St. Francis Manor and the campus to what it is today. Countless projects and services have been created under Dion’s leadership including:

  • Seeland Park, a 55+ community began in 1989 and will consist of 150 retirement homes once the development of Phase VI has been completed;
  • Community Services of St. Francis has been operational since 2007 and provides home health care services;
  • St. Francis Manor Foundation, a 501(c)3 organization was established in 2008;
  • A $5.25 million construction and renovation project added a commercial-sized kitchen and rehabilitation clinic for in-patient and out-patient therapy services.
